                @ronaldb66 @Pepijn Cities in the late 1800s were drowning in horse manure, so they needed some form of horseless mass transport to get the workers to the factories. Wuppertal sits on very hard granite and excavating for an underground system would have been prohibitively expensive. So, they decided to use the space over the river instead and then later expanded over the street into Vohwinkel.
